"Of course, all of the software I write runs on Linux; that's the beauty of standards, and of cross-platform code. I don't have to run your OS, and you don't have to run mine, and we can use the same applications anyway!"
About this Quote
The punch is in the inversion of power. Historically, operating systems have been gatekeepers: they decide what software "counts", what gets distribution, what gets support. Zawinski flips that relationship by moving status from the OS to the code. Cross-platform becomes a way to demote the operating system to just another substrate, a replaceable layer rather than a sovereign territory.
Context matters: this reads like late-90s/early-2000s open-source confidence, when Linux was a statement and proprietary desktops were still cultural empires. There's also a pragmatic hacker ethos beneath the manifesto. He isn't praising standards because they are elegant; he's praising them because they let him keep shipping without asking permission. The final clause - "use the same applications anyway!" - is the mic drop: compatibility as the ultimate act of refusing to take sides while very much taking one.
